Top 5 Best 75232 Texas Public Schools (2025)

For the 2025 school year, there are 9 public schools serving 3,947 students in 75232, TX (there are , serving 501 private students). 89% of all K-12 students in 75232, TX are educated in public schools (compared to the TX state average of 94%).
The top ranked public schools in 75232, TX are Mark Twain School For The Talented And Gifted, D A Hulcy Steam Middle School and Martin Weiss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public schools in zipcode 75232 have an average math proficiency score of 33% (versus the Texas public school average of 41%), and reading proficiency score of 40% (versus the 51% statewide average). Schools in 75232, TX have an average ranking of 3/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Texas public schools.
Minority enrollment is 99% of the student body (majority Black), which is more than the Texas public school average of 75% (majority Hispanic).
